Minneapolis, MN – P.O.S, Sims, Lazerbeak, Mike Mictlan, Paper Tiger, Cecil Otter and Dessa — collectively known as Minneapolis-bred Hip Hop crew Doomtree — are back with their first single in five years.

Titled “Five Alive,” the track is full of unbridled energy and Doomtree’s signature sound. Every member of the crew is clearly armed with the same thirst they had when their journey began, making it seemingly easy to pick up where they left off.

“We started this thing because we were fans of each other,” Sims tells RealStreetRadio. “We wanted to create a place where any of us could create anything we wanted, and it could find a place to thrive.

“I think through that ethos, we were sort of able to each create our own planets, all orbiting around the pull of this strange arts collective/record label/band/publishing house/whatever we decide is next. Because of the drive of each member, it’s rare when all these planets line up but to me, it’s special when they do.”

Doomtree hasn’t released a crew album since 2015’s All Hands. As Sims pointed out, they’ve all been busy pursuing their own individual paths.

Although plans for a follow-up have yet to be revealed, “Five Alive” is a solid indicator the wheels are in motion.
